HOUSTON, GA, February 13, 2009
/24-7PressRelease/ -- RAI recently expanded its large systems expertise by hiring engineers from the former Linux Networx ( LNXI ). They bring with them the proven experience in deploying large and complex systems at a variety of high performance computing centers. These centers include the Army Research Laboratory, Los Alamos National Laboratory, Lawrence Livermore National Laboratory, ECMWF, Aeronautical Systems Command, The Boeing Company, Northrop Grumman Corporation, and ATK Corporation, among others. In fact, many of the new RAI team designed and commissioned the last large LNXI system delivered to the Army Research Lab.

About RAI
RAI is a privately-held, Houston-based firm that has been focused on the meeting the compute needs of the Oil & Gas business. The company has been building HPC clusters and the associated high-end engineering workstations for the exploration and seismic processing requirements of our clients for over thirty years. RAI offers custom integration services to design, develop, optimize and support systems that are specifically tailored to customers' needs. We use open source software solutions with leading edge, high-performance commodity hardware, complemented by RAI enhancements that are specific to the HPC environment.
